Energy efficiency

Triple and double glazing is a great option to make your home more energy efficient. They can cut down on cost of energy and noise pollution, as well as improve your home's comfort. They also can add value to your property.

The energy efficiency of windows can be increased by replacing the single pane glass with double glazed units. They are made up of two glass panes, and the space between them which can be filled with air or an inert gas, such as argon. The air space between two glass panes acts as an insulator, which slows the loss of thermal energy and reduces loss of heat. This can lead to lower energy bills and a reduction in carbon emissions.

The use of energy-efficient glass is an essential part of a home improvement project. When combined with loft and cavity wall insulation, it can dramatically reduce your heating expenses. It can also help to reduce high-frequency and medium-frequency noise. This can make your home more peaceful and comfortable while reducing stress from living in an urban environment.

Building Regulations that set minimum thermal performance standards require new triple or double-glazed windows and door to meet these standards. These regulations take into consideration the frame and internal components of the window as along with the glazing. This is important because it is not just the glass that affects the loss of heat from a building. In addition, double-glazed windows can help reduce condensation and improve air circulation.

Modern triple and double glazing is more efficient in insulating than older windows. This is due in part to improvements in frames, coatings, and locks gas options. Double-glazed windows and doors could have a U-value of 1.5W. A double-glazed window that is older could have a U value higher than 3.0W.

When it is acoustic insulation the thickness of the glass has an immediate impact on the sound reducing ability of the door or window. Acoustic glass is made up of at least two sheets of glass that are bonded with a layer acoustic Polyvinyl Butyral (PVB). The thickness of this layer minimizes the sound waves and absorbs energy.

The tightness of sashes and frames is another factor locks that impacts acoustic performance. The frames should ideally be fusion-welded to avoid gaps or leaks between the frames of the sash. The frames must be correctly measured and fitted to prevent micro-gaps that could let outside noise in your home.
